BMW 4 Series420i M Sport 2dr Step Auto
2024
2,143 miles
Petrol
£42,995
£42,995
was
£32,995
£700 off£52,895
£34,395
£39,195
£27,990
£21,595
£18,995
£34,195
£41,350
£62,195
£34,295
£47,495
£67,295
£26,195
£39,495
£37,695
£51,495
397-414 of 600 vehicles